introduction to the canada eta
The Canada eTA is an online requirement for visa-exempt foreign nationals who fly to or transit through a Canadian airport. It helps the Canadian government determine if a traveler poses a risk to the health, safety, or security of Canada. The application process is relatively straightforward, but following the instructions carefully is crucial to avoid delays or refusals.
canada eta cost
The cost of a Canada eTA is $7 CAD, a non-refundable fee paid online using a credit or debit card, such as Visa, Mastercard, or American Express. The eTA fee is only payable on the official Canada eTA website. Be cautious of third-party websites that charge additional fees for their services. These websites often claim to offer assistance with the application process but can end up costing you more.
applying for a canada eta
To apply for a Canada eTA, you need to provide personal and travel information, including your passport details, contact information, and travel plans. You can apply online through the official Canada eTA website. The application process typically takes a few minutes to complete, and most applications are approved within minutes. In some cases, you may need to submit additional documentation, which can delay the processing time. For instance, if you have a complex travel history, you may need to provide more information to support your application.
validity of a canada eta
A Canada eTA is valid for five years or until your passport expires, whichever comes first. If you renew your passport, you'll need to apply for a new eTA. It's essential to ensure that your eTA is valid for the duration of your stay in Canada. You can check the status of your eTA online through the official Canada eTA website. This is especially important if you plan to travel to Canada multiple times within the five-year period.
avoiding common mistakes
When applying for a Canada eTA, there are some common mistakes to avoid. Applying through a third-party website can result in additional fees. Providing incorrect or incomplete information can lead to delays or refusals. Not paying the eTA fee is also a common mistake, as it's required for all applications. Not checking the status of your eTA can result in travel delays. To avoid these mistakes, apply through the official Canada eTA website and follow the instructions carefully. You can also check the status of your eTA online to ensure it's valid for the duration of your stay in Canada.
